After tasting the whole range from Argiolas you also realise how they got to this blend.
This is stunning, it absorbed 18 months of new oak easy.
Cannonau gives the freshness and the fruit with the carignan, the bovale donates the tannin and the floral shade and Malvasia Nera the aromatic.
Super velvety, fresh, complex and above all long.
It goes without saying this is only a baby. — 10 months ago

Great wine indeed. Nose is complex, camphor, dry amarena cherry, some flint, no oxidation not fading on this bottle yet.
On the palate, Fruit is gone for this bottle, wine is dominated by its tannic structure that is on the dry side, almost austere. I was expecting a fleshier, mellower tannin. Dry herbs, dry raisins, cherry again.
Long finish, good acidity that’s keeps the wine alive and well going.
Mitigate the intensity with proteins and juice/sauce.
Osso bucco with prunes will work. We did Fiorentina and it was ok. The crust and smokiness did not help, over exhibiting the dryness of tannins. — 8 years ago

Personally i found this the great surprise of the line up.
Mainly Bovale finished off with some cannonau and carignan.
9 months of new barrique which the wine digests incredibly well.
Nice fruit, but the floral that the Bovale gives to the wine truly fascinates me and keeps me interested during every sip. Spices too plus leather and tobacco.
Tannin that will get smoother, but is already enjoyable.
Long finish
Serious alternative for cabernet drinkers
It is not the Turriga, but honestly i did not remember its beauty. Very elegant — 10 months ago
